Earlier on the afternoon of the 3rd, a post was posted on Nate Pan, saying, “I’m so tired of the noise between the floors of a couple of celebrities in the upper house.” The author of the post, Mr. A, said, “I really think about it hundreds of times, and then I upload it. There is a person who has moved to the house above my home in the beginning of last year. According to the story I heard by accident at a real estate site, singer Mina and my husband, Philip, were at the house above us I was lucky to live.”

Mr. A continued, “A year ago, I started thumping in the upper house. I understood at first because we are also raising babies. The problem is that it doesn’t just end with thumping. I understand until daytime or at least 10 pm. “The problem is, even at 1~2am, I don’t know if I scream and sing, play drums or treadmills, but it makes noises seriously until late in the morning for an average of 3~4 times a week. We also refer to it. “It’s been a year since I endure it and report it,” he said.

He said, “This year’s New Year holiday, a note was posted on the door at the house above. They’re noisy because of their livelihood, so they’ll be careful, so please understand. At that time, it was more than a YouTuber. I am an ordinary office worker. I also have to sleep at least late at night because of my work, so I go to work the next day.

Mr. A said, “My baby is just over two years old. When I sing late at night and sing loudly in the upper house, the baby who sleeps with difficulty wakes up crying and crying because of the noise from the upper house. It’s common to wake up while crying two or three times a week. My family is all too stressed out and getting very neurosis,” he said. I think there are courtesy to keep to each other. I was really angry when I heard that the people living in the upper house were Mina and Philip through the real estate.”
